Scope and Contents

The collection contains a range of material types including manuscripts, correspondence, and articles created by Martha Linsley Spencer (1875-1954), resident and poet of Hartford, Connecticut. Manuscript writings include poems, holographs (both original and preservation photocopies), as well as typed prose and unsorted notes from throughout her career as a writer. The collection also houses two proofs of her published work "Remembered Years, Collected Poems", with one containing holograph manuscript pages. Correspondence includes letters regarding her work and personal life, as well as her communication with other notable poets such as Edna St. Vincent Millay, Wallace Stevens, and W.B. Yeats. Other files within the collection are related to specific poetry groups and publications from the Hartford area which Spencer was a part of (i.e. the Poetry Club of Hartford and Connecticut Troubadour), and materials from various individuals organized and collected by Spencer herself. Also collected by Spencer are periodicals and articles (both related and unrelated to her work), as well as miscellaneous papers, manuscript notes, and ephemera relating to The Poetry Club of Hartford, "The Poet's Corner" column, and her position as poetry editor of the Hartford Times.

Biographical / Historical

Martha Linsley Spencer was born October 28, 1875, to Connecticut residents George Francis Spencer and Esther Ann Linsley. Throughout her career as a writer, she served as editor to The Hartford Times' poetry column, "Poet's Corner", and also as Chairperson of the program committee for the Poetry Club of Hartford. Her career in poetry allowed her to correspond with other notable writers of the period such as Edna St. Vicent Millay and W.B. Yeats. In addition to writing for The Hartford Times, her short story titled "Nutmegs are Wooden", a tale of how Connecticut became known as the Nutmeg State, was published in Yankee Magazine in April 1947. Her only published book of poetry, "Remembered Years, Collected Poems" (Hartford, Conn.: Press of Finlay Bros.), which was limited to 500 copies, was printed after her death in 1954. She was then 79 years old.

Arrangement

Collection is arranged by material type. There are 9 series: Series I: Manuscript writings Series II: Proofs Series III: Printed works Series IV: Correspondence Series V: Files related to specific poetry groups and publications Series VI: Files related to individuals Series VII: Periodicals and articles collected by Spencer Series VIII: Ephemera Series IX: Miscellaneous

Immediate Source of Acquisition

This collection was a donation of Mrs. Leon Hart in memory of her sister, Martha L. Spencer, in 1957.
